Svend Hammershøi for Kähler, jardiniere.
Rectangular ceramic jardiniere/ herb pot with ribbed relief decoration and rare yellow uranium glaze. Designed during the art deco period with distinctive geometric styling.
Origin: Denmark.
Designer: Svend Hammershøi (1873–1948).
Material: Ceramic with uranium glaze.
Dimensions: H. 7 cm, D. 7 cm, L. 31 cm.
Period: 1930s.
Condition: Excellent condition with minor signs of wear.
Bio:
Svend Hammershøi (1873–1948) was a Danish ceramicist and designer renowned for his important work with Kähler Keramik in Næstved. Brother of painter Vilhelm Hammershøi, he created some of Kähler’s most iconic forms, often characterised by classical proportions, fluted decoration, and sophisticated glazes. His works from the first half of the twentieth century are considered among the most important contributions to Danish ceramic design.
